Sope Creek Dam
Key Takeaway
Sope Creek Dam is classified as low hazard in Georgia.
Physical Details
| Dam Height | 25 ft (taller than 58.1% in GA) |
| Dam Length | 200 ft |
| Dam Type | Earth |
| Max Storage | 28 acre-ft |
| Normal Storage | 15 acre-ft |
| NID ID | GA07100 |
Safety Information
No probable loss of human life and low economic/environmental losses expected.
Hazard potential describes downstream consequences of failure, not the dam's current condition. What does this mean?
Ownership
DOI NPS
Federal Government

What is the hazard classification of Sope Creek Dam?
Sope Creek Dam is classified as Low Hazard. No probable loss of human life and low economic/environmental losses expected. This classification refers to the potential downstream consequences of a failure, not the dam's current structural condition.
Who owns and operates Sope Creek Dam?
Sope Creek Dam is owned by DOI NPS (Federal Government). The owner is responsible for maintenance, inspections, and compliance with dam safety regulations.
How tall is Sope Creek Dam?
Sope Creek Dam has a dam height of 25 ft. Dam height is measured from the natural streambed at the downstream toe to the top of the dam, and may differ from the visible height.
When was Sope Creek Dam last inspected?
Sope Creek Dam was last inspected on June 28, 2017. Inspection dates indicate when a formal review occurred, not the results of that inspection.
